Gallagher v. State

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Fourth District
Aug 24, 2005
909 So. 2d 463 (Fla. Dist. Ct. App. 2005)

Opinion

No. 4D04-2591.

August 24, 2005.

Appeal from the Circuit Court for the Seventeenth Judicial Circuit, Broward County; Geoffrey D. Cohen, Judge; L.T. Case No. 01-6738 CF10A.

Carey Haughwout, Public Defender, and Margaret Good-Earnest and Marcy K. Allen, Assistant Public Defenders, West Palm Beach, for appellant.

Charles J. Crist, Jr., Attorney General, Tallahassee, and Katherine Y. McIntire and Richard Valuntas, Assistant Attorneys General, West Palm Beach, for appellee.


Kevin Gallagher filed a rule 3.850 motion raising several challenges. We reverse and remand for further proceedings in connection with his seventh point, which we find legally sufficient. See Grosvenor v. State, 874 So.2d 1176 (Fla.), cert. denied, ___ U.S. ___, 125 S.Ct. 627, 160 L.Ed.2d 458 (2004). The remaining issues were properly denied.

STEVENSON, C.J., GUNTHER and HAZOURI, JJ., concur.
